A new look for the Lounge Chair Atelier
Vitra Campus, Weil am Rhein
In the Lounge Chair Atelier customers can select the materials of their Lounge Chair by Charles & Ray Eames, receiving personalised advice from the VitraHaus team, and then watch the final steps in the manufacturing process for their new favourite armchair. Located on the ground floor of the VitraHaus, this large workshop has now been refurbished.
The design of the updated Lounge Chair Atelier is inspired by the character and prestige of the Eames Lounge Chair. The calm, tranquil interior features natural, earthy colours and offers a wealth of information about the furniture classic, as well as insights into its artisanal production.

Visitors gain an overview of all the materials available for the Lounge Chair – from different veneer types to the choice of leathers. And to ensure that customers can focus on making the right choices for their new favourite spot to relax, the atelier has been furnished with elegant wood, soft carpets and graphic prints on leather to create a reflective, inspirational atmosphere.
Once the components have been selected, the individual parts are presented to the customer on a leather mat before final assembly – each one a symbol of functional beauty.
